Originally Posted by TheOak View Post
Lets see.

After two weeks


2013 Two week total Rob Ryan ~ Atlanta & Tampon Bay
Points allowed / 31
Passing yards allowed - 392
Rushing yards allowed - 248
Total yards allowed - 640
Sacks - 6
INT - 2


2012 Two week total Steve Spagnuolo ~ Washington & Carolina

Points allowed / 75
Passing yards allowed - 573
Rushing yards allowed - 372
Total yards allowed - 945
Sacks - 3
INT - 2


I've got em big and hairy enough to call him the second coming.

Savior

REASON WE ARE 2-0!

Also, we lost our best NT about 30 seconds after the National Anthem in game 1, we also lost a key back-up DE/DT (TWalker) in that game too.

We then lost our 3rd DE/DT early in game 2 (Tom Johnson) and were playing without a promising young DE in Glenn Foster.

Ryan has done better than I could have imagined.
